2. RESPONSIBILITIES OF THE BOARD
The NBTE was established by Act 9 of 1977,
with the following responsibilities, among others:
a) To advise the Federal Government on and coordinate all
aspects of technical and vocational education falling
outside the Universities;
b) To determine, after consultation with the National
Manpower Board, Industrial Training Fund and such other
bodies as it considers appropriate, the skilled manpower
needs of the country in the industrial, commercial and other
relevant fields for the purpose of planning training
facilities and in particular to prepare periodic master
plans for the balanced and coordinated development of
polytechnics.
c) To inquire into and advise the Federal Government on the
financial needs, both recurrent and capital, of Polytechnics
and other technical institutions to enable them meet the
objectives of producing the trained manpower needs for the
country;
d) To advise on, and take steps to harmonize entry
requirements and duration of courses at technical
institutions;
e) To lay down standards of skills to be attained and to
continually review such standards as necessitated by
technology and national needs.
The National Minimum Standards and Establishment of
Institutions Act of 1985 and Amendment Act of 1993 extended
the function of the Board to include the establishment and
maintenance of minimum standards in Polytechnics and other
technical institutions in the Federation, accreditation of
academic programmes in all Technical and Vocational
Education (TVE) institution for the purpose of award of
national certificates and diplomas and other similar awards,
and recommendation for the establishment of Private
Technical Institutions in Nigeria.
3. DUTIES OF THE EXECUTIVE SECRETARY
The Executive Secretary is the Chief
Executive Officer of the Board, as well as the Secretary of
the Governing Board, and shall be responsible for the
execution of the policy of the Board and the day-to-day
running of the affairs of the Board.
